Pengelompokan Penyakit Pada Pasien Berdasarkan Usia Dengan Metode K-Means Clustering (Studi Kasus : Puskesmas Bahorok) Tanty Tanty; Budi Serasi Ginting; Magdalena Simanjuntak
ALGORITMA : JURNAL ILMU KOMPUTER DAN INFORMATIKA Vol 5, No 2 (2021): November 2021
Publisher : UIN Sumatera Utara

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.30829/algoritma.v5i2.10508

Abstract

In this study, the process of applying the K-Means method will be carried out in classifying diseases in bahorok health center patients based on age. To simplify the process of managing a lot of data, the Bahorok Health Center needs a system in making decisions to find out the grouping of diseases based on the age of patients who are often affected by the disease at the Bahorok Health Center. The application of the K-Means Clustering method is a method used in data mining which works by finding and classifying data that have similar characteristics between one data and other data that has been obtained. As for the results. The results of the pattern analysis above From 20 data obtained 3 groups, it can be concluded as follows: Group 1 Centroid 1: (2.2 1.4 2.2) there are 5 data. Based on the above calculations, it can be seen that in cluster 1 group 1, the patients are children. Group 2 Centroid 2: (1 1,6 1,6) there are 3 data. Based on the above calculations, it can be concluded that in cluster 2, group 2 is an adult patient. Group 3 Centroid 3: (1,75 1,58 6) there are 12 data. Based on the above calculations, it can be concluded that in cluster 3, group 3 is the patient is the elderly. Keywords : K-Means, Diseases in Patients

Noise Removal Pada Citra Digital Dengan Menggunakan Metode Active Contour Randika Setyansyah; Yunita Sari Siregar; Mufida Khairani
ALGORITMA : JURNAL ILMU KOMPUTER DAN INFORMATIKA Vol 5, No 2 (2021): November 2021
Publisher : UIN Sumatera Utara

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.30829/algoritma.v5i2.10700

Abstract

Disturbance in the image, especially digital images can be caused by noise, resulting in a decrease in the quality of the image. Image restoration is a technique used to recover the original image from a degraded image. Restoration is intended so that the information contained in a digital image becomes better/clear. The restoration process is carried out because the image quality is blurred or because of the noise contained in the image. Noise is the main problem encountered in digital image processing. The digital image restoration process always involves a filtering algorithm that is able to suppress the noise contained in the image. The active contour method is one approach to segmentation, where this method uses a closed curve that can move wide or narrow. The active contour process is a process that takes some of the signals of a certain frequency and discards signals at other frequencies. An initialization curve is placed outside of the object to be segmented, then through the iteration process the curve will move closer to the boundary of the object until finally finding the object boundary. This study aims to design a special system for character restoration in digital images using the active contour method. The implementation results show that the active contour method can be used to restore the image properly, this can be from the restored image, the condition of the image that has been given noise can approach the initial data. Keywords: active contour, digital image, character, restoration

Jaringan Syaraf Tiruan Memprediksi Pemasangan Saluran Air Bersih Pengguna Baru Menggunakan Metode Backpropagation pada PDAM Tirta Sari Binjai Nanda Wahyudi Nasution; Magdalena Simanjuntak; Marto Sihombing
ALGORITMA : JURNAL ILMU KOMPUTER DAN INFORMATIKA Vol 5, No 2 (2021): November 2021
Publisher : UIN Sumatera Utara

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.30829/algoritma.v5i2.10509

Abstract

Regional Drinking Water Company (PDAM) is a company engaged in clean water supply services, one of the goals of the establishment of PDAM is to meet the needs of the community for clean water, including the provision, development of facilities and infrastructure services, as well as clean water distribution. PDAM Tirta Sari Binjai as the person in charge of clean water needs in Binjai City installs water connection installations at customers' homes which usually come from the mountains then flows into rivers and is collected first in reservoirs and then distributed to customers' homes . PDAM Tirta Sari Binjai has experienced problems in handling the large number of applications for new connection installations. And to overcome these problems we need a method that can predict the number of new installations. Based on these conditions, PDAM Tirta Sari Binjai needs to create a system that can predict the number of installations of clean water lines that will come in the following days or months. The process of predicting the number of installations of clean water lines that will be carried out with a computerized system, one of the processes that can be done is the application of an Artificial Neural Network (ANN) using the Backpropagation method. The system is designed with the MATLAB R2014a programming application, after carrying out the data training process and data testing on 2016 to 2020 data, the learning rate is 0.2; the maximun epoch is 10000 and the target error is 0.001, the result is that in 2021 the number of installations of clean water channels is 2,238 channels. Keywords: Backpropagation, Artificial_Syaraf_Network, Clean_Air_Channel

Analisis Penentuan Kelayakan Judul Skripsi Mahasiswa dengan Metode Profile Matching dan TOPSIS Boni Oktaviana Sembiring; Yunita Sari Siregar
ALGORITMA : JURNAL ILMU KOMPUTER DAN INFORMATIKA Vol 5, No 1 (2021): April 2021
Publisher : UIN Sumatera Utara

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.30829/algoritma.v5i1.9953

Abstract

The selection of a proper student thesis title really requires precise accuracy, because there are often similarities with existing thesis or discrepancies with the vision and mission of the study program. The supervising lecturer is the one who selects the feasibility of the student thesis title, where the number of students being mentored is sometimes more than 3 people. Therefore we need a method that can assist in making decisions to determine the feasibility of student thesis titles. The method used in this research is Profile Matching and Topsis. Profile Maching is a method that is often used in decision making where the stages in the method consist of determining criteria, determining the gap value, calculating the core factor value and secondary factor value, the sum of the core factor and secondary factor values and then the final conclusion or final selection. While Topsis is one of the methods in a decision support system where the steps in this method are to normalize the matrix and determine the ideal positive and negative matrix solutions so as to produce values from the largest to the smallest. The criteria used consist of title renewal (K1), suitability of the study program vision (K2), suitability of study program mission (K3), suitability of specialization courses (K4), and similarity of research with previous titles (K5). In this study, it was found that the TOPSIS method produces an accuracy value of 80% and is effectively better than the results of the Profile Matching method with an accuracy of 60% in making decisions about whether the student title is feasible or not. Keywords: TOPSIS, Profile Matching, Eligibility of Thesis Title
